Transaction e80531f51b548f819f14ed4fc6cd7638571ade23fbe230fd937bfdbd573a4daf
1 Input
1 Output
-
e80531f51b548f819f14ed4fc6cd7638571ade23fbe230fd937bfdbd573a4daf:0
- value
- 27405853
- script pubkey
- OP_0 OP_PUSHBYTES_20 1146fbe212b5c7786ee4bc037c0a0a8052f5c285
- address
- ltc1qz9r0hcsjkhrhsmhyhsphczs2spf0ts59xs98uq